The outside temperature indicator shows the outside temperature in a range from −22 to 1228F (−30 to 508C).

The indicator can give a false reading under any of the following conditions:
- When there is too much sun.

- During idling; while running at low speeds in a traffic jam; when the engine is restarted immediately following a shutdown.

- When the actual outside temperature falls outside the specified indicator range.
